The is a single-chip Trusted Platform Module (TPM) from the SafeKeeper™ family designed to provide hardware-level security for PC-Client platforms. It is commonly used in modular TPM cards, such as the ASUS TPM-SPI module, to enable advanced security features like BitLocker and fulfill Windows 11 installation requirements. Core Specifications & Standards

The is a single-chip hardware cryptographic module belonging to Nuvoton’s SafeKeeper™ family . It is explicitly designed to meet the Trusted Computing Group (TCG) TPM 2.0 standard . This hardware-level security chip provides robust cryptographic capabilities to modern computing systems. It handles key generation, encryption, and platform integrity checks directly on-die.
